Responsibilities:
- Receive, unpack, and verify incoming shipments.
- Pick, pack, and prepare orders for shipment accurately and efficiently.
- Stock and organize inventory in designated warehouse locations.
- Conduct regular inventory checks and assist with cycle counts.
- Operate material handling equipment as needed, following all safety procedures.
-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ment.
- Adhere to all company safety guidelines, including proper use of PPE.
- Collaborate with team members to meet daily operational targets.
- Assist with other warehouse tasks as assigned.
- Ensure quality control throughout the picking and packing process.
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or GED.
- Previous warehouse or general labor experience is beneficial.
- Ability to perform physical duties, including frequent lifting (up to 50 lbs).
- Basic understanding of inventory management principles.
- Commitment to workplace safety and the correct use of PPE.
- Good communication and teamwork skills.
- Reliable and punctual attendance.
- Familiarity with general logistics operations.
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
- Must be able to stand and walk for extended periods.
